Professor Brain was experimenting to create waves that increase the brain power, but his experiments went horribly wrong (as always) and made every person DUMB.

Now they don't even know what to do in their daily lives. So he quickly makes an app where people can post their questions and get replies from YOU. Don't look surprised there is an app for literally anything these days.

Explore the Gameplay of Dumbocalypse

Your job is to reply people the best you can in order to keep the balance of this planet. Just be cautious.

Don't populate the earth too much
Don't make the humans go extinct
Don't make them too sad
Don't make them too happy

See how simple this was. Now go on help those poor souls and don't forget to have fun!
